Mezzanine House is a refined exploration of spatial clarity, materiality, and texture, balancing contemporary minimalism with warmth. A curated palette of concrete, metal, and timber fosters a sense of openness, lightness, and flexibility, while seamless transitions between rooms enhance both function and aesthetic integrity.
Materials such as textural timber, smooth concrete, and matte metal invite sensory engagement, creating a timeless atmosphere. Natural light flows through large windows, connecting the interior with coastal views and deepening the spatial experience. This dialogue between interior and exterior is further reinforced by cabinetwork that mirrors the home’s architectural forms.
Public and private zones are carefully delineated, with open-plan living spaces oriented towards the coast, while private areas offer intimacy further inside. Sustainability strategies prioritize natural light, ventilation, and durable, low-maintenance materials. The design ensures comfort, flexibility, and longevity, offering adaptable spaces that accommodate both family life and private moments with a timeless elegance.
Inspired by the coast the design embraces easy living with seamless indoor-outdoor spaces that invite the ocean breeze and sunlight into our home. For our family of five, the open-plan layout encourages connection, while private retreats allow for quiet times. The one-bedroom apartment above reflects thoughtful planning, offering flexibility for empty nesting and visiting family. Our home balances beauty and practicality, allowing us to work, play, and relax with ease. It offers us everything we need as a family & will for transitioning years.
